Why the Hype About Ozempic? More Than Just a Fad

Ozempic, a GLP-1 receptor agonist, isn’t just another weight loss trend; it’s backed by robust scientific research and FDA approval. It works by suppressing appetite and regulating blood sugar—key factors in sustainable weight loss. Addressing Potential Risks with Proactive Management

While Ozempic’s safety profile is well-established, vigilance remains essential. Risks such as nausea, gastrointestinal discomfort, or rare instances of pancreatitis necessitate proactive management strategies. Routine blood work, symptom tracking, and open communication with your healthcare team enable early detection and intervention, mitigating potential complications.

Furthermore, emerging research suggests that long-term GLP-1 therapy might influence pancreatic function in susceptible individuals. Ongoing surveillance and individualized risk assessments are crucial to balance benefits and safety effectively.

How Do Risks and Side Effects Shape Long-Term Treatment Strategies?

While Ozempic boasts a favorable safety profile, proactive management of side effects is essential for sustained success. Gastrointestinal issues like nausea can often be mitigated through dose adjustments and dietary modifications. Routine medical supervision ensures that any emerging concerns are addressed promptly, reducing the risk of discontinuation. Emerging research suggests that long-term therapy requires ongoing surveillance to prevent rare complications such as pancreatitis, emphasizing the importance of expert oversight.
